I have pretty much all the same predators here. When they are in the open areas the birds of prey will get them. In the wooded areas they are up for grabs from all the four legged preys. I give them different types of things to hide under in the pasture, wooden boxes, traps and the like. In the woods they have bushes to hide under and around. I don't clip any wings, this gives the chickens a chance to fly up into the trees. No matter what you do. you will lose some to predators.
